Named after the late Assistant City Manager , who established the original "Safe Zone" in 2004, the center was built by Keystar Construction . Groundbreaking : April 2024. Ribbon Cutting : June 18, 2025.

: The 10,000+ square foot building includes climate control, proper restrooms (replacing fair-style trailers), laundry facilities, and a dedicated food preparation area.

The facility, which officially opened in , marks a shift from a temporary overnight site to a 24-hour navigation center designed to transition residents back into the mainstream.

: The concrete structure is elevated and hurricane-rated, allowing it to serve as an emergency shelter during storms. Community Impact

: Operated by the nonprofit Cornerstone Resource Alliance , the center provides on-site case management and supportive services.

Key West recently celebrated the completion of the , a modern 150-bed homeless shelter that replaces the former Keys Overnight Temporary Shelter (KOTS). This $8.5 million facility on Stock Island is the first permanent brick-and-mortar shelter in Monroe County. A New Era for Support Services
